A Flitch Beam is a composite section comprised of one or more steel plates attached to a wood beam. They are typically used to reduce the structural depth of an equivalent wood-only beam. A timber joist is strengthened by addition of a steel plate on the top and bottom, the three members being securely bolted together at the intervals. famous loopholesWebFeb 1, 2024 · • Taught myself Wood design while designing Wooden structural elements including composite steel & wooden Flitch beam … copper range hood backsplashWebThe bigger issue with flitch beam design is the bolted connection between the two materials. Calculating shear flow along the member and the required bolt size and spacing to transfer the shear to the adjacent members is critical to proper flitch beam design. Dowel bearing strength of the wood is typically limiting. famous looney tunes
